随着人工智能技术的飞速发展和应用场景的不断丰富,执行动态代码的需求愈发旺盛,尤其是在AI代理、教育平台及开发者工具中,能够安全、高效地运行用户提交的代码成为关键挑战。然而,不同计算环境和供应商之间的不兼容性以及复杂的基础设施部署,常常使开发者感到棘手,影响产品的快速迭代与创新。ComputeSDK的出现,正是为了解决这一痛点,打造一个统一且开放的沙箱计算解决方案,让代码执行变得简单、灵活且安全。ComputeSDK不仅抽象多家底层计算提供商的复杂性,还提供跨平台热切换能力,极大提升了开发与运维效率。它的设计理念类似于云基础设施领域的Terraform和CloudFormation,通过统一的接口标准化不同计算资源的调用,使开发者能够专注于业务逻辑而非底层细节。ComputeSDK的核心功能是创建隔离的沙箱环境,支持多种语言代码的安全运行,同时自动完成环境配置、身份验证和资源管理。
开发者只需调用简洁的API即可轻松开启、运行甚至销毁沙箱,这种一体化体验有效降低了集成门槛。基于多供应商策略,ComputeSDK实现了一种供应商中立的计算架构。无论是在企业级的Firecracker微虚拟机上,还是在支持Node.js和Python的全球无服务器环境中,都能无缝交替使用计算资源,避免单一平台瓶颈风险,带来更强的弹性和稳定性。更值得关注的是,这种架构保障了开发的高度灵活性,团队不必重新设计认证流程和API对接,减少切换供应商的运维成本。ComputeSDK非常适合需要安全执行LLM生成代码的AI应用,也适合在线代码沙箱教学等场景,为用户提供隔离且即时的代码反馈环境。在开发者工具领域,它可助力实时代码执行,为调试和实验提供极大便利。
通过简化动态代码执行方式,ComputeSDK推动了开发者快速构建和部署创新型产品。其开放源码策略让社区能够积极贡献和扩展功能,未来将支持更多的计算供应商及高级功能,例如自托管Kubernetes环境、代码版本管理服务以及数据存储能力,极大地丰富了应用生态。除基础功能外,ComputeSDK还计划引入完善的监控与可观测性工具,帮助运维团队实时掌控沙箱性能和安全状态,提高整体运维效率和用户体验。对于企业而言,ComputeSDK不仅带来了技术层面的革新,更代表了未来开发基础设施的发展方向 - - 简单、灵活、面向AI时代的智能辅助。开发者能够摆脱传统环境限制,快速响应市场变化,将更多精力投入到产品价值创造中。作为开源项目,ComputeSDK已经在GitHub上线,文档完善,便于开发团队无缝集成和使用。
社区的成长和不断壮大使得这个平台具有持续发展的动力,也为人工智能及动态代码执行领域树立了新标杆。如果你正在为如何安全高效地运行外部代码而苦恼,ComputeSDK无疑是值得关注的重要工具。它不仅解放了开发者的生产力,也为多样化计算资源的合理利用提供了范例。未来,随着更多支持的加入和功能的完善,ComputeSDK有望在全球范围内推动开发基础设施的革新,助力构建更加智能和安全的计算生态系统。通过这一统一计算沙箱方案,开发者将拥有真正跨平台的自由和效率,为应用创新开辟广阔空间,迎接AI驱动的新时代。 。